What happens when the people who spend the most time in a school building finally have a say in its design? In this episode of Laying the Foundation, we are joined by Principal Architect Courtney Koch to explore the transformative power of incorporating student voices into K12 architecture. We discuss the shift from designing for students to designing with them, examining how authentic engagement, from interactive design charrettes to student shadowing, leads to spaces that foster ownership, safety, and inspiration. Join us as we dive into the practicalities of inclusive design and why the most important insights often come from the students themselves.

Leading the Way with Mike Thole: Design Build

In this episode of Laying the Foundation, we sit down with Mike Thole, an Associate Principal at CMBA Architects, to demystify the increasingly popular "Design-Build" project delivery method. Moving beyond the traditional silos of design-bid-build, Mike explains how bringing architects and contractors together from day one creates a unified "three-legged stool" of collaboration between the owner, the designer, and the builder. The discussion dives into the practical benefits of this model, from real-time cost transparency and accelerated schedules to the critical role of team chemistry, while also identifying which project types are best suited for this integrated approach. Whether you’re an owner looking for more certainty in your next build or an industry professional navigating a shifting landscape, this conversation offers a clear roadmap for understanding how partnership-driven design is shaping the future of the built environment.
